What Does “Impressively Accurate Pass” Mean in Football Slang?

Simply put, an impressively accurate pass refers to a pass made during a football match that is not just on target but also executed with a level of precision that wows the crowd, teammates, and commentators alike. It’s about hitting your teammate in the sweet spot—whether it’s a long ball over defenders or a tight little dink between legs.

Think of it as the football equivalent of threading a needle or hitting a bullseye on a dartboard. The pass not only needs to reach its target, but it must do so under pressure and in a way that creates an opportunity to score or maintain possession.
